Can BCA eliminate or reduce the problems we have with damaged bearings?
Yes. The tolerance on bearings such as roller bearings and journal bearings is quite low (as low as 0.3 to 0.5 microns). When small polar molecules attach themselves to bearing internals, it forms varnish and sludge that trap particles, and eventually cause grinding or adhesive wear. ISOPur purifies to the sub-micron level and removes varnish, allowing bearings to move as designed without grinding or adhesion. Varnish deposits also divert the oil flow, causing loss of “oil wedge” in journals.
